Water softener rep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ues with existing water softening systems to ensure they function effectively. Technicians assess the unit’s components, such as the resin tank, brine tank, and control valve, to identify problems like clogs, leaks, or malfunctioning parts. Repairs may include replacing worn-out valves, cleaning mineral buildup, or restoring the system’s ability to regenerate properly. Proper repair work can help restore the softener’s capacity to reduce hard water minerals, improving water quality throughout the property.
These services address common problems associated with water softeners, such as reduced efficiency, salt bridging, or complete system failure. Hard water can lead to scale buildup in plumbing fixtures, appliances, and pipes, causing damage and decreasing lifespan. Repair technicians can resolve issues like resin bed fouling, electronic controls malfunctioning, or salt delivery problems. Timely repairs help prevent more extensive damage, ensuring the water softening system continues to operate reliably and maintain the desired water quality.

The overview below groups typical Water Softener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Indian Head,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The typical cost for water softener repairs ranges from $150 to $500, depending on the issue and the parts needed. Minor repairs, such as replacing a valve or sensor, tend to be on the lower end of this range. More extensive repairs can push costs toward the higher end.
Service Call Fees - Many service providers charge a diagnostic or service call fee that can range from $50 to $100. This fee is often applied toward the total repair cost if work is authorized.
Replacement Parts - The cost of parts like resin tanks, control valves, or filters varies, typically from $50 to $300. The overall repair expense depends on the parts required and the labor involved.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for water softener repairs generally fall between $75 and $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the complexity of the repair and the time needed to complete it.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why is my water softener not working properly? A local service provider can diagnose issues such as salt bridging, resin problems, or valve malfunctions that may cause the softener to malfunction.
How often should a water softener be repaired? Repair frequency depends on usage and system condition; a professional can assess the system and recommend maintenance or repairs as needed.
What are common signs that my water softener needs repairs? Signs include reduced water softening effectiveness, strange noises, or increased water hardness levels, which can be addressed by a local technician.
Can a water softener be repaired if it’s leaking? Yes, leaks can often be fixed by replacing faulty valves, fittings, or seals, which a local repair specialist can perform.
